![]() ![]() ![]() The top left corner of the Minecraft Launcher contains the user's Xbox gamertag for the currently active account (which might differ from their Minecraft: Java Edition username). On the left side, a "News" tab, a tab for each game, and the Minecraft Launcher "Settings" tab can be seen. If a user attempts to log in with a Mojang Studios or legacy Minecraft account, they will be directed to migrate to a Microsoft account. Subsequent logins can be done in the "Settings" tab. Unbelievable Shaders: Gorgeous lighting effects and texture rendering tweaks to make Minecraft feel more alive than ever. Thaumcraft: Boosts the enchantment system massively with a bunch of powerful spells that can be added to weapons and items. Mo Creatures: Adds 32 new species to the game, including crocodiles, foxes, ogres and werewolves.įlans Mod: Fight them on the beaches, and in the forests and the mines and everywhere else with this pack full of World War 2 themed planes, vehicles and weapons. Technic Pack: A huge bundle of mods that overhaul many aspects of the game to massively up the number of buildings and contraptions you can construct.
